Mr C's

7420 South Shields Boulevard, Oklahoma City
Categories: Convenience store  Establishment 

Suggest updates

Reviews

1
Nov 17, 2019

Matthew Allenbaugh

Nasty bathroom's and rude people...


Write a review

The nearest companies